6. Local SEO

Local SEO directly influences the visibility and effectiveness of “san miguel near me” searches. It comprises a set of practices designed to optimize a business’s online presence, ensuring it appears prominently in local search results. The causal relationship is clear: robust Local SEO enhances the likelihood that a business selling San Miguel will appear when a user performs a “san miguel near me” query. Without effective Local SEO, a relevant business risks being buried in search results, effectively becoming invisible to potential customers actively seeking their product. For example, a convenience store with a complete selection of San Miguel products, but poorly optimized local SEO, may not appear in a “san miguel near me” search, losing potential sales to a competitor with better online optimization.

One critical component of Local SEO is claiming and optimizing a Google Business Profile (GBP). This involves providing accurate business information, including name, address, phone number (NAP), hours of operation, and product/service offerings. Maintaining consistent NAP information across all online platforms is crucial for search engine verification and ranking. Actively managing and updating the GBP with photos, posts, and responding to customer reviews signals to Google that the business is engaged and relevant, further boosting its Local SEO. For example, a restaurant that regularly updates its GBP with new menu items featuring San Miguel products and responds promptly to customer reviews is more likely to rank higher in local searches.

Question 1: What constitutes a “near me” result in the context of this search?

The proximity calculation is typically based on the user’s current location as determined by GPS, Wi-Fi triangulation, or IP address. Search engines and mapping applications employ algorithms to rank results based on distance, prioritizing locations closest to the user’s detected position.

Question 2: How accurate are the location results provided by a “san miguel near me” search?

Accuracy varies depending on the precision of the user’s location data and the quality of the underlying retailer data. Geolocation technologies are subject to limitations, and retailer information may be outdated or incomplete. Discrepancies may occur, necessitating verification with the identified retailer.

Question 3: What factors influence the ranking of search results beyond geographical proximity?

Several factors beyond distance influence search rankings. These include the retailer’s online presence, search engine optimization (SEO), customer reviews, product availability, and store hours. Retailers with stronger online profiles and positive customer feedback tend to rank higher in search results.

Question 4: Does the “san miguel near me” search indicate real-time product availability at identified locations?

Typically, the search provides location data but does not guarantee real-time product availability. Contacting the retailer directly to confirm stock levels is advised. Some retailers may provide online inventory information, but this is not universally available.

Question 5: How do advertising and sponsored listings affect the objectivity of “san miguel near me” search results?

Advertising and sponsored listings can influence the placement of search results. Paid listings may appear prominently, even if they are not the closest options. Users should exercise discernment when evaluating search results and consider both organic and paid listings.

Question 6: What steps can be taken to improve the accuracy and relevance of “san miguel near me” search results?

Ensuring location services are enabled on the device, providing accurate address information, and refining search queries with specific product details can enhance the accuracy and relevance of results. Regularly clearing browser cache and cookies may also improve performance.

Optimizing “San Miguel Near Me” Search Results

This section offers practical guidance to retailers aiming to enhance their visibility and attract customers through “San Miguel near me” searches. Implementing these strategies can improve search engine rankings and drive foot traffic.

Tip 1: Claim and Optimize Google Business Profile (GBP). A complete and accurate GBP is crucial. Ensure the business name, address, phone number (NAP), and website are consistent across all online platforms. Add high-quality photos of the business and its products. Respond promptly to customer reviews.

Tip 2: Maintain NAP Consistency. Ensure the business Name, Address, and Phone number (NAP) is consistent across all online platforms, including the business website, social media profiles, online directories, and citation sites. Inconsistencies can confuse search engines and negatively impact rankings.

Tip 3: Encourage and Respond to Customer Reviews. Positive customer reviews enhance credibility and improve search rankings. Actively solicit reviews from satisfied customers and respond to all reviews, both positive and negative, in a professional and timely manner.

Tip 4: Utilize Local Keywords. Incorporate relevant local keywords into the business website content, GBP description, and social media profiles. For example, use phrases like “San Miguel beer [city name]” or “best selection of San Miguel near [neighborhood].”

Tip 5: Optimize Website for Mobile Devices. Ensure the business website is mobile-friendly and loads quickly on mobile devices. A positive mobile experience is essential for attracting customers who are searching for “San Miguel near me” on their smartphones.

Tip 6: Manage Inventory Data. If feasible, implement a system to display real-time or near real-time inventory data online. This allows customers to confirm product availability before visiting the store, enhancing convenience and reducing wasted trips.

Tip 7: Participate in Local Community Events. Sponsoring or participating in local community events increases brand visibility and strengthens the business’s connection to the local community. This can indirectly improve search rankings and drive foot traffic.

Tip 8: Monitor Search Performance. Regularly monitor search engine rankings and website traffic to track the effectiveness of optimization efforts. Use t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console to identify areas for improvement.
